Saturday 14 April 2012, 7pm - 9.30pm, Family Bats Walk
The course will inlcude a brief introductory talk about the type of bats particpants migth expect to see, an illustrated talk about bats and a chance to see bat speciments close up iin the classroom. Places must be reserved in advance. £6 per person.
